Job Description

Our client, a global fintech software company with tremendous culture, is hiring for a contract Project Coordinator II. This is a fully remote position with EST hours highly preferred (Local to Atlanta is preferred but not required).

As part of the GTM Programs & Operations team within the company's Global Partner Ecosystem, the Project Coordinator II plays a pivotal role in ensuring operational excellence across the systems, tools, and workflows that support the App Partner Program and App Marketplace.

You will support process improvement, system integration, and data transparency across the partner journey, from onboarding through ongoing engagement to ensure our partners experience a predictable, seamless, and scalable operational experience.

Overall, we are seeking someone with a passion for program execution, process improvement, and partner enablement, who thrives in a cross-functional, fast-paced environment.

Contract Duration: 8 Months to Start and offering competitive benefits , paid holidays , and strong potential to extend.

Key Responsibilities:

Workflow Transparency & SLA Management

  • Manage and continuously improve the Marketplace listing workflow, from partner submission to publication.
  • Create transparency across all stages of the listing journey, ensuring partners and stakeholders have real-time visibility into status and timelines.
  • Track and enforce SLA performance across internal teams and external review vendors, identifying bottlenecks and driving timely resolution.

Process Optimization & Continuous Improvement

  • Identify inefficiencies, redundancies, and friction points in the current listing workflow; propose and implement solutions to simplify and accelerate the process.
  • Partner with Product Operations and Systems teams to automate workflows, integrate tools, and improve data flow across platforms.
  • Establish standardized documentation, templates, and dashboards to monitor progress and drive continuous improvement.

Cross-Functional Program Coordination

  • Partner closely with the Solutions Engineering, Tech, and Program Ops teams to ensure
  • aligned workflows and clear accountability.
  • Align stakeholders on process updates, metrics, and timelines, ensuring shared visibility and consistent execution.
  • Facilitate regular operational reviews to track performance, surface insights, and recommend improvements.

Operational Reporting & Insights

  • Define and maintain key performance metrics for the listing workflow (e.g., turnaround times, SLA compliance, queue health, partner feedback).
  • Develop reporting cadences and dashboards to communicate operational health to leadership and partner teams.
  • Use data and insights to proactively recommend process or tool enhancements.
  • Work with Salesforce and Tableau (experience with these is preferred)

What You'll Bring:

  • 5+ years of experience in program operations, program management, or process management, preferably within a B2B SaaS or partner ecosystem environment.
  • Proven track record of optimizing workflows and driving SLA adherence across multiple stakeholder groups.
  • Strong analytical mindset and ability to leverage data for decision-making and performance tracking.
  • Excellent communication, organization, and stakeholder management skills; able to coordinate across internal and external teams.
  • Experience with workflow automation tools (e.g., Jira) and dashboarding (e.g., Tableau) preferred.
  • A bias for action, able to turn ambiguity into structure and deliver measurable process improvements.
